Had my first trip to Rock Lake. It is a really nice large lake. It was about 30-36 degrees out, and we were on the water by 6:15 am and it was still dark. Weather was cold and soaking wet. A little snow early but quickly changed to rain, and alot of it. We started by casting for Browns in the rock reefs. Spent a couple hours doing this with no luck. We switched over to trolling. Within 30 minutes of switching, I got my first brown on a hot-shot brown trout patter. It was an honest 13-14 inch brown, with a nice hook jaw. Then about 20 minutes later my fishing buddy got a smaller rainbow on I believe a flat fish of some type. A little later I hooked into a larger rainbow, about 17 inches with substantial girth. She jumped several times and put a good fight. We needed a net to land her. We only caught 3 fish between 3 of us. The weather chilled my buddies to the bones, I was fine in my 6 layers plus rain gear however taking a pee off the side of the boat was like brain surgery.
